Weldon’s humor and vulnerability make her someone readers want to root for and allow her to feel like a treasured friend.”  – Booklife / Publishers Weekly \n\n\n\n\nAbout LisaLisa Stapleton Weldon\, a graduate of Auburn University\, has spent a lifetime in advertising in Atlanta. Her hobby? Walking cities and sharing the stories she finds. \n\n\n\n\n\n\n\nAt age 58\, Lisa took a month out of her life to learn the new tools of her trade\, social and digital media. She sliced of map of Manhattan into 20 pieces\, with the goal of walking: one piece per day until she covered the entire island. At night she pored over instructional videos and blogged about the neighborhoods she’d walked. The following year she replicated that 30-day journey in Paris\, and has since walked Shanghai\, Istanbul\, and several counties in Central America.  \n\n\n\nHuffPost has featured her walk of Paris on the front cover of the “Living Fearlessly” section. Oprah’s network Harpo Productions invited Lisa to be a guest with Cindy Crawford. She currently contributes travel content for Melissa Gilbert’s Modern Prairie online community. \n\n\n\nHer current project is Blood Sisters\, a story of a forbidden friendship during the Civil Rights Era.
